2026 Best Value English Language & Literature Schools in New York

Below are the schools that deliver the strongest value in english language & literature, balancing cost against outcomes.

Best Value English Language & Literature Schools

1

Cuny Bernard M Baruch College earned the #1 spot for value among english language & literature schools in New York. Set in the city of New York, Cuny Bernard M Baruch College is a very large public institution. Students from in state pay about $7,464 in tuition and fees, with out-of-state students paying around $15,414. English Language & Literature graduates carry a median of $15,000 in student loans. Early-career english language & literature graduates make about $61,459. Set against $15,000 in median debt, that is a healthy payoff. Cuny Bernard M Baruch College admits about 48% of applicants.

Notes and References

This list is compiled by College Factual (MF_RANKING_2025), 2026 edition. Schools are scored on the balance of cost (tuition and student debt) against student outcomes (post-graduation earnings) — a measure of return on investment, drawn primarily from the U.S. Department of Education (IPEDS and College Scorecard).

Ranking method: College Major Best Value · 112 schools evaluated.

*Averages shown above reflect the top 45 ranked schools only.
